注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學技術(shù)計算機/網(wǎng)絡(luò)軟件與程序設(shè)計其他編程語言/工具MATLAB R2012a完全自學一本通

MATLAB R2012a完全自學一本通

MATLAB R2012a完全自學一本通

定 價:¥79.80

作 者: 劉浩
出版社: 電子工業(yè)出版社
叢編項:
標 簽: 程序設(shè)計 計算機/網(wǎng)絡(luò)

ISBN: 9787121188329 出版時間: 2013-01-01 包裝: 平裝
開本: 16開 頁數(shù): 772 字數(shù):  

內(nèi)容簡介

  本書面向MATLAB的初中級讀者,在介紹MATLAB R2012a集成環(huán)境的基礎(chǔ)上,對MATLAB使用中常用的知識和工具進行了詳細的介紹,書中各章均提供了大量有針對性的算例,供讀者實戰(zhàn)練習。根據(jù)內(nèi)容的側(cè)重點不同,全書分為20章:第1~5章為基礎(chǔ)部分,講解MATLAB概述、數(shù)學計算基礎(chǔ)知識、數(shù)組和矩陣、編程基礎(chǔ)及數(shù)據(jù)的可視化等;第6~8章為數(shù)學應(yīng)用部分,講解數(shù)據(jù)分析與處理、符號數(shù)學計算和概率統(tǒng)計等;第9~15章為工程應(yīng)用部分,講解偏微分方程、優(yōu)化、圖像處理、信號處理、小波分析等工具箱、Simulink基礎(chǔ)及應(yīng)用等;第16~20章為知識拓展部分,講解句柄圖形、GUI編程、文件I/O、編譯器和應(yīng)用程序接口等內(nèi)容。為了使用戶能夠更好地操作MATLAB,本書中示例的命令都記錄在M文件及其他相關(guān)文件中,用戶可以將相關(guān)的目錄設(shè)置為工作目錄,直接使用M文件進行操作,以便快速掌握MATLAB的使用方法。

作者簡介

暫缺《MATLAB R2012a完全自學一本通》作者簡介

圖書目錄

目錄
第1章 MATLAB R2012A概述1
1.1 MATLAB R2012a簡介2
1.1.1 MathWorks及其產(chǎn)品概述2
1.1.2 MATLAB的發(fā)展歷史2
1.1.3 MATLAB與其他數(shù)學軟件3
1.1.4 MATLAB的主要特點4
1.1.5 MATLAB的系統(tǒng)組成4
1.1.6 MATLAB工具箱簡介5
1.1.7 MATLAB R2012a新特性6
1.2 MATLAB R2012a的安裝與卸載7
1.2.1 系統(tǒng)要求7
1.2.2 安裝過程7
1.2.3 MATLAB 的卸載10
1.3 MATLAB R2012a的目錄結(jié)構(gòu)10
1.4 MATLAB R2012a的工作環(huán)境11
1.4.1 Start按鈕11
1.4.2 菜單欄12
1.4.3 工具欄16
1.4.4 命令窗口(Command Window)17
1.4.5 工作空間(Workspace)18
1.4.6 命令歷史窗口(Command History)19
1.5 MATLAB R2012a的通用命令20
1.6 MATLAB R2012a的文件管理21
1.6.1 當前目錄瀏覽器和路徑管理器21
1.6.2 搜索路徑及其設(shè)置21
1.7 MATLAB R2012a的幫助系統(tǒng)23
1.7.1 純文本幫助23
1.7.2 演示(Demos)幫助24
1.7.3 幫助導航瀏覽器26
1.8 MATLAB使用初步27
1.9 本章小結(jié)28
第2章 MATLAB基礎(chǔ)知識29
2.1 數(shù)據(jù)類型30
2.1.1 數(shù)值類型30
2.1.2 邏輯類型34
2.1.3 字符和字符串36
2.1.4 函數(shù)句柄39
2.1.5 結(jié)構(gòu)體類型41
2.1.6 單元數(shù)組類型44
2.1.7 單元數(shù)組類型(cell)45
2.1.8 map容器類型48
2.2 基本矩陣操作52
2.2.1 矩陣和數(shù)組的概念及其區(qū)別52
2.2.2 矩陣的構(gòu)造53
2.2.3 矩陣大小及結(jié)構(gòu)的改變57
2.2.4 矩陣下標引用58
2.2.5 矩陣信息的獲取61
2.2.6 矩陣的保存和加載65
2.3 運算符71
2.3.1 算術(shù)運算符71
2.3.2 關(guān)系運算符73
2.3.3 邏輯運算符74
2.3.4 運算優(yōu)先級75
2.4 字符串處理函數(shù)76
2.4.1 字符串的構(gòu)造76
2.4.2 字符串比較函數(shù)77
2.4.3 字符串查找和替換函數(shù)78
2.4.4 字符串——數(shù)值轉(zhuǎn)換79
2.5 本章小結(jié)80
第3章 數(shù)組與矩陣81
3.1 數(shù)組運算82
3.1.1 數(shù)組的創(chuàng)建和操作82
3.1.2 數(shù)組的常見運算85
3.2 矩陣操作89
3.2.1 創(chuàng)建矩陣89
3.2.2 改變矩陣大小94
3.2.3 重構(gòu)矩陣96
3.3 矩陣元素的運算96
3.3.1 矩陣加減運算96
3.3.2 矩陣乘法運算98
3.3.3 矩陣的除法運算99
3.3.4 矩陣的冪運算100
3.3.5 矩陣元素的查找100
3.3.6 矩陣元素的排序101
3.3.7 矩陣元素的求和102
3.3.8 矩陣元素的求積102
3.3.9 矩陣元素的差分103
3.4 矩陣運算104
3.4.1 矩陣分析104
3.4.2 矩陣分解110
3.4.3 特征值和特征向量116
3.5 稀疏矩陣118
3.5.1 稀疏矩陣的存儲方式119
3.5.2 稀疏矩陣的生成119
3.5.3 稀疏矩陣的運算124
3.6 本章小結(jié)124
第4章 MATLAB編程基礎(chǔ)125
4.1 M文件編輯器126
4.2 變量128
4.2.1 變量的命名128
4.2.2 變量的類型129
4.2.3 MATLAB默認的特殊變量129
4.2.4 關(guān)鍵字130
4.3 MATLAB的控制流130
4.3.1 順序結(jié)構(gòu)130
4.3.2 if-else-end分支結(jié)構(gòu)131
4.3.3 switch-case133
4.3.4 try-catch結(jié)構(gòu)135
4.3.5 for循環(huán)結(jié)構(gòu)136
4.3.6 while循環(huán)結(jié)構(gòu)137
4.4 控制程序流的其他常用指令139
4.4.1 return指令139
4.4.2 input和keyboard指令139
4.4.3 yesinput指令139
4.4.4 pause指令140
4.4.5 continue指令140
4.4.6 break指令140
4.4.7 error和warning指令141
4.5 腳本和函數(shù)141
4.5.1 腳本141
4.5.2 函數(shù)142
4.5.3 M文件的一般結(jié)構(gòu)144
4.5.4 匿名函數(shù)、子函數(shù)、私有函數(shù)與私有目錄146
4.5.6 重載函數(shù)148
4.5.7 eval、feval函數(shù)和內(nèi)聯(lián)函數(shù)148
4.5.8 內(nèi)聯(lián)函數(shù)151
4.5.9 向量化和預(yù)分配154
4.5.10 函數(shù)的函數(shù)154
4.5.11 P碼文件155
4.6 M文件中變量的檢測與傳遞157
4.6.1 輸入/輸出變量檢測指令157
4.6.2 “可變數(shù)量”輸入/輸出變量157
4.6.3 跨空間變量傳遞159
4.7 MATLAB程序的調(diào)試162
4.7.1 程序調(diào)試的基本概念162
4.7.2 直接調(diào)試法163
4.7.3 使用調(diào)試函數(shù)進行調(diào)試163
4.7.4 工具調(diào)試法167
4.7.5 程序的性能優(yōu)化技術(shù)168
4.8 小結(jié)170
第5章 數(shù)據(jù)可視化171
5.1 圖形繪制172
5.1.1 離散數(shù)據(jù)及離散函數(shù)172
5.1.2 連續(xù)函數(shù)173
5.1.3 圖形繪制示例174
5.1.4 圖形繪制的基本步驟175
5.2 二維圖形繪制175
5.2.1 plot指令176
5.2.2 格柵182
5.2.3 文字說明182
5.2.4 線型、標記和顏色185
5.2.5 坐標軸設(shè)置188
5.2.6 圖形迭繪189
5.2.7 子圖繪制190
5.2.7 交互式繪圖191
5.2.8 雙坐標軸繪制192
5.2.9 fplot繪圖指令193
5.2.10 explot繪圖指令195
5.2.11 特殊坐標軸繪圖195
5.2.12 二維特殊圖形函數(shù)197
5.3 三維圖形繪制202
5.3.1 曲線圖繪制202
5.3.2 網(wǎng)格圖繪制203
5.3.3 曲面圖的繪制204
5.3.4 光照模型205
5.3.5 繪制等值線圖206
5.4 四維圖形可視化207
5.4.1 用顏色描述第四維207
5.4.2 其他函數(shù)208
5.5 本章小結(jié)209
第6章 數(shù)據(jù)分析211
6.1 多項式及其函數(shù)212
6.1.1 多項式的表達式和創(chuàng)建212
6.1.2 多項式求根213
6.1.3 多項式的四則運算214
6.1.4 多項式的導數(shù)、積分與估值216
6.1.5 多項式運算函數(shù)及操作指令217
6.1.6 有理多項式218
6.2 數(shù)據(jù)插值219
6.2.1 一維插值220
6.2.2 二維插值223
6.3 函數(shù)的極限224
6.3.1 極限的概念224
6.3.2 求極限的函數(shù)224
6.4 函數(shù)數(shù)值積分226
6.4.1 數(shù)值積分問題的數(shù)學表述227
6.4.2 一元函數(shù)的數(shù)值積分227
6.4.3 多重數(shù)值積分229
6.5 本章小結(jié)230
第7章 符號數(shù)學計算231
7.1 MATLAB符號計算概述232
7.2 符號對象和符號表達式232
7.2.1 符號對象的創(chuàng)建命令232
7.2.2 符號對象的創(chuàng)建示例233
7.2.3 符號計算中的運算符和函數(shù)236
7.2.4 符號對象的類別識別函數(shù)240
7.2.5 符號表達式中的變量確定242
7.2.6 符號精度計算242
7.3 符號表達式操作244
7.3.1 符號表達式顯示244
7.3.2 符號表達式合并244
7.3.3 符號表達式展開245
7.3.4 符號表達式嵌套246
7.3.5 符號表達式分解247
7.3.6 符號表達式化簡247
7.4 符號表達式替換249
7.4.1 subs替換函數(shù)249
7.4.2 subexpr替換函數(shù)250
7.5 符號函數(shù)的操作251
7.5.1 復合函數(shù)操作251
7.5.2 反函數(shù)操作252
7.6 符號微積分253
7.6.1 符號表達式的極限253
7.6.2 符號表達式的微分254
7.6.3 符號表達式的積分256
7.6.4 符號表達式的級數(shù)求和257
7.6.5 符號表達式的泰勒級數(shù)257
7.7 符號積分變換258
7.7.1 傅里葉變換及其反變換258
7.7.2 拉普拉斯變換及其反變換259
7.7.3 Z變換及其反變換260
7.8 符號代數(shù)方程求解261
7.9 符號微分方程求解264
7.10 符號分析可視化266
7.10.1 funtool分析界面266
7.10.2 taylortool分析界面269
7.11 本章小結(jié)270
第8章 概率統(tǒng)計271
8.1 產(chǎn)生隨機變量272
8.1.1 二項分布的隨機數(shù)據(jù)的產(chǎn)生272
8.1.2 正態(tài)分布的隨機數(shù)據(jù)的產(chǎn)生272
8.1.3 常見分布的隨機數(shù)產(chǎn)生273
8.2 概率密度計算274
8.2.1 通用函數(shù)概率密度值274
8.2.2 專用函數(shù)概率密度值276
8.3 累積概率分布277
8.3.1 通用函數(shù)累積概率值277
8.3.2

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) www.dappsexplained.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號